Overview
Experience Anchorage through its local flavors on this small-group food and sightseeing city tour. Taste a sampling of some of the best dishes that Alaska has to offer while learning about the history of this great state and its hardy people and soaking up the best views in Anchorage.
- Uncover the food scene of Anchorage with the insider knowledge of a local guide
- Enjoy the relaxed pace and laidback atmosphere of a small-group tour
- Go beyond the guidebooks with facts and insights from your guide
- Head off the beaten path to explore Anchorage beyond tourist hotspots

Vyvyanne_G, Jul 2026
Anchorage has many yummy locations to enjoy delicious bites. My favorite on this tour was the Lucky Wishbone Diner. The fried chicken drumstick, hushpuppies with honey butter, and the peach milkshake were so good, and the people were so welcoming! Benji's Bakery & Cafe, and él Green-Go's were tasty too. We also visited Motley Moo Creamery, which had yummy ice cream, but I actually prefer Wild Scoops on 5th Avenue. Try the Baked Alaska Cone with wild blueberry ice cream!!!
Anchorage has some beautiful scenery, especially when the weather is nice. Alaska gets quite a bit of rainfall, so pack your raincoat.
Moose are abundant, but sometimes elusive, so don't be too disappointed if you don't see one on this tour. Our driver, Luke, had wonderful stories about growing up in, and living in Alaska. He was very nice, funny too.
Ask your guide to go to Beluga Point when the tide is not low, if possible. Unfortunately there were no Beluga Whales for us to see with a very low tide. That was disappointing, but we don't control the weather or the tides.
It is a beautiful area, and the nearby waterfall is lovely. Seeing Lake Hood Seaplane Base, and many of the brightly painted floatplanes was interesting.
However, I think it would be nice to see more sites on this tour. If the weather had not been rather rainy and cold, we might have seem more sites. For example, Anchorage has many beautiful murals that are worthy of photography. It was very sweet of Luke to drop us off at our hotel. He is a very nice guide, and loves sharing Anchorage with guests.
